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$198.41 | 3.743% | $205.8365 | $205.84 | $205.85 | $205.80 |
Purchase #2 | $26.51 | 10.374% | $29.2601 | $29.26 | $29.25 | $29.30 |
Purchase #3 | $196.61 | 6.871% | $210.1191 | $210.12 | $210.10 | $210.10 |
Purchase #4 | $224.57 | 11.859% | $251.2018 | $251.20 | $251.20 | $251.20 |
Purchase #5 | $199.73 | 10.721% | $221.1431 | $221.14 | $221.15 | $221.10 |
Purchase #6 | $86.90 | 3.142% | $89.6304 | $89.63 | $89.65 | $89.60 |
Purchase #7 | $204.98 | 4.217% | $213.624 | $213.62 | $213.60 | $213.60 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,137.71 | $1,220.8150 | $1,220.81 | $1,220.80 | $1,220.70 |
